Helps clients to build an individualized education pathway plan, working to:
- explore education and training options, such as skills upgrading, high school credits, training, apprenticeship, post-secondary, and employment
- make sure that the plan meets the client's goals
- identify strengths and any upgrading needs
- connect with the programs and services needed
- determine eligibility for training funding

Eligibility
Assessment is designed for those who:
- want to upgrade their skills, or are unsure of their skills
- want to get into training, apprenticeship or post-secondary programs
- have been out of school for many years (including those with Grade 12)
- need to complete their Grade 12 diploma or equivalent
- need prerequisite courses for a training, apprenticeship, or post-secondary program
